Plants grow up to two-feet-tall and have a tendency to run, so be sure to give them space. Also well-suited for trellising. 80 days to full maturity. 50 seeds per packet. CULTURE: After danger of frost has passed, sow seeds 2" apart, 1" deep in rows 36" apart. Plants have a tendency to run and will vine if trellised. Immature seeds can be cooked fresh or pods can be left to dry on the vine.
